Abstract :
The sensitivities of three main categories of time-of-flight recoil ion mass analyzers were compared. Optimum beam parameters were determined for a given detector area by using the method of Lagrange multipliers. Dimensionless sensitivity coefficients were calculated for various analyzer geometric parameters. For a selected analyzer size and detector diameter, the sensitivity ratio of two different types of instruments can be read directly from Tables 9 to 11. These ratios were tabulated for a given primary ion beam thickness and for a fixed, common resolution, respectively. Remarkable sensitivity increases can be obtained by using cylindrical reflectrons but at the expense of resolution loss. A specific example also illustrates the expected performances of three geometries belonging to the three analyzer categories.
